openacc
对比了下OPENCL和OPENACC发现OPENACC有许多OPENCL没有的优点。
OPENACC没有OPENCL那么对显卡深入,可以降低编程难度,被简称为后CUDA,就像CUDA那么一样简便的编写程序。
我搜索了下,居然发现这几年来都没什么动静,太可怕了,人家NV早已经发布了套件了,AMD居然没有动静。
这个时代并不是纯粹的拼硬件,纯粹拼硬件的时代已经过时了,还要拼软件。
如果软件都用NV显卡加速,而AMD显卡却没什么作用,AMD显卡怎么卖出去呢? 还记得天国的Brook+和Stream么。。。 不明觉厉 那些工具都是非常专业的人员才能用 AMD还没醒啊,以为硬件性能牛B了就行了,没软件支持,硬件再牛B也不行啊,还得发展软件支持啊。
原本性能10的硬件,没有软件支持,发挥不了性能也是白搭,有软件能用,但是没优化只发挥2-3成的性能,那也是白搭。
还不如性能5的硬件,发挥8-9成的性能。 open cc 效率会比较低。。但感觉能降低门槛总是好的。 害怕,技术流开始炫知识了,我们红队要不要学习一下,搞一个红队分享会啊{:5_138:} 效率低一点,只要软件足够多,就没什么问题,哪怕效率再高,没几个软件,也是白搭啊。
页:
[1]